    Fonar was a dispute between medical device manufacturer Fonar Corporation and General Electric over Fonar's patent on MRI technology. Fonar's founder, Raymond Damadian, was issued U.S. Patent 3,789,832 (priority date 1972-03-17) [2] for an "apparatus and method for detecting cancer in tissue" using the magnetic resonance of atoms.

    In 1978, Damadian formed his own company, Fonar [32] (which stood for "Field Focused Nuclear Magnetic Resonance"), for the production of MRI scanners, and in 1980, he produced the first commercial one. Damadian's "focused field" technology proved significantly less efficient and slower than Lauterbur's gradient approach.
